12 Jul ¿Por qué hacer un curso de programación full stack online?
En la actualidad, un desarrollador full stack es una de las profesiones más solicitadas en los portales de búsquedas de trabajo. Con el avance tecnológico y el uso de internet en todas las empresas, en todos los negocios y también en los estudios, el conocimiento de todo lo relacionado a la web es fundamental para una excelente salida laboral.
Para aquellos que quieran desarrollar una carrera relacionada con la tecnología, como lo es el desarrollador full stack, hacer un curso de javascript online es lo recomendado, ya que es fundamental aprender para entender el lenguaje de programación como de secuencias de comandos para poder realizar y determinar funciones complejas en los sitios web.
Teniendo en cuenta que la tarea de este tipo de profesional es manejar todo los que se relacione con la creación de una aplicación para la web, como asimismo con el mantenimiento correspondiente de dicha aplicación, nada más adecuado que hacer un curso online full stack para, de ese modo, estar a la altura de las necesidades de cualquier empresa que esté a la búsqueda de ese profesional.
Qué es exactamente un programador full stack?
Un programador full stack es el funcionario primordial en todo departamento de desarrollo de una empresa. Es el profesional que sabe cómo diseñar una aplicación web, cómo programarla y cómo mantenerla. Por ese motivo, un curso de javascript online será sumamente importante para quien quiera desarrollarse en esa área.
Pero es necesario saber exactamente qué significa ‘full stack’ para poder comprender su importancia. ‘Stack’ es el espectro de tecnologías que son usadas en la programación web y abarca desde las relacionadas al usuario hasta las relacionadas a los servidores. El stack se divide en dos partes conocidas como front-end (lo relacionado con el usuario) y back-end (lo relacionado con el servidor). Un curso online full stack es el curso ideal para abarcar ambas partes del stack y convertirse en un desarrollador completo.
Por qué un programador full stack es más solicitado?
En primer lugar, se debe entender que javascript es un lenguaje de programación necesario para la creación de páginas web dinámicas, que son aquellas páginas con efectos especiales, como por ejemplo:
- Párrafos de textos que aparecen y desaparecen
- Imágenes animadas
- Botones que, al pulsarlos, activan acciones
- Ventanas que contienen avisos para el usuario
Todos los programas que son creados con javascript corren en cualquier navegador y no necesitan procesos intermedios para que eso suceda.
Es un paso importante poder dominar javascript, para desarrollar las dos partes del stack: front-end y back-end. Con todos esos conocimientos, un desarrollador full stack conseguirá empleo con mayor facilidad. Puesto que, como lo dicho anteriormente, es una de las profesiones más solicitadas en los portales de búsqueda de empleos!
Absolutamente todo tipo de negocios en la actualidad poseen páginas web, desde una gran empresa multinacional hasta un pequeño comercio de barrio. En la era de la tecnología, en la que la gente busca información directamente en internet de cualquier clase de asunto, tener una página web es fundamental para ganar y para mantener clientes.
Por ese motivo, un buen diseño web es necesario para atraer al público. Y ese diseño puede decirse que se divide en tres ítems:
1.La relación con el usuario, conocido como front-end, que tiene que ver con la presentación de la página web, su aplicación o el servicio que ofrece.
2. El conocido back-end, que es la parte que valida la información a través del servidor.
3.La base de datos, que es el ítem que hace un control del intercambio de información.
Hace un tiempo eran tres ítems trabajados por más de un funcionario. Sin embargo, en la actualidad, un programador full stack cubre las tres funciones y es eso lo que interesa a las empresas de un modo general ya que, si un único funcionario es capaz de crear y mantener una aplicación de inicio a fin, será fundamental contratarlo!
Por eso, estudiar, aprender, desarrollar los conocimientos adquiridos mediante la práctica será muy importante para terminar siendo un profesional competente en la función de programador full stack.